Polk Cubs edge Hampton in thrilling District 5 final
In frigid gym air Polk wins 56-54 over Hampton to claim the Class D District 5 crown and advance to regional play. Dana Anderson led Polk early with inside baskets while Roger Carlstrom scored 16 before fouling out. Hampton battled back with Som Schrader and Dean Klute in a tense fourth period but Polk held on.

Polk Cubs Nips Gresham 52 51 In Class D District Play
Roger Carlstrom drove the winning shot after a missed attempt, then scored on the rebound to lift Polk Cubs over Gresham 52 51. Carlstrom totaled 28 points on 14 field goals, with Dana Anderson 11 and Doug Branz 17 for Gresham, Haberman 11 and Liedtke 10 for Polk.

Deb Wolfe Elected Student Senator at Chadron State College
Deb Wolfe of Polk has been elected student senator at Chadron State College. An English major and daughter of Mr and Mrs Don Wolfe, she is active in English Goals Organization, Psychology Club, Daughters of the Crossed Swords, and Student Education Association. She will aid the English Department as a senator.
